Can you tell us the difference between on-page and off-page SEO. On-page SEO involves optimizing various elements on your website that impact your search engine rankings and overall off-page optimization efforts. It requires regular updates to maintain or improve your ranking. Key components of on-page optimization include the page title, high-quality content, URL structure, meta description tag, optimized images with alt tags, page performance, and internal linking.

What is a backlink? Backlinks are incoming links to a website or web page from another site. When one website links to another, it signifies the content’s importance. Search engines like Google consider backlinks as a ranking signal. High-quality backlinks can improve a web page’s rankings and visibility on search engines. Q12. What is Google Sandbox? The Google Sandbox Effect suggests that new websites are often plac on probation, unable to rank effectively for their main keywords.

An XML sitemap is a file that lists all the URLs of a website, helping search engines like Google to crawl and index the site’s content more efficiently. It provides valuable information about each URL, such as when it was last updat and how important it is in relation to other URLs on the site.

 

In SEO, XML sitemaps are important because they help search engines discover and index new content faster, especially for large websites with complex structures. They also provide insights into the website’s structure and organization, helping search engines understand the site’s hierarchy and prioritize crawling accordingly.

What is the difference between a do-follow and a no-follow link? Do-follow links are links that search engines can follow to reach a website, acting as backlinks that enhance a site’s ranking. By default, all hyperlinks are do-follow.

Keyword density refers to the number of times a keyword appears on a given webpage. It is the percentage density of a particular phrase or keyword available on a website compared to the total number of words on a particular page.

Keyword difficulty or competition refers to how challenging it is to rank for a specific keyword in Google’s organic search results. This difficulty is influenced by various factors, including the quality of content, domain authority, and page authority.

 

What is a long-tail keyword? Long-tail keywords are phrases consisting of more than three words that make search results highly specific.
